NSB-Omega is looking for an Intermediate Drilling Engineer for one of our major clients in St. John's, NL
Assignment Description
Works with JVAsset Manager to develop an effective influencing campaign. Establishes and maintains a healthy, cooperative relationship with the operator's drilling & wells team.
Responsible to generate Wells cost estimates as required.
Responsible to identify Wells related project risks.
Responsible to review technical plans and processes.
Responsible to maintain listings of active regional JV projects.
Obtains the upcoming JV Non-Operated Drilling Program from the Regional Asset / Exploration Managers.
Validates technical well design for class 4 & 5 wells.
Monitors daily operations and provides technical expertise and feedback to assist operator.
Participates in joint technical team meetings, partner planning meetings, partner operations review meetings and ad hoc partner meetings.
Provides daily, weekly and monthly reporting to Regional Wells Director and JV Manager
Communicates significant Wells EHSevents/incidents to Regional Wells Director and regional EH&S; department JV contact.
Ensures that appropriate escalation of operational issues and over-expenditures occurs.
Incorporate and share lessons learned with Wells regions.
Qualifications Required
>5 years experience in offshore well construction, intervention, and abandonment activities
Registered with PEGNL as a professional engineer
Conversant with offshore well construction standards, practices, and processes
Experience with well construction stage-gated processes
Interpersonal skills and ability to influence through non-authoritative leadership
Experience with subsea and platform well developments
Excellent communication in English and people management skills
Knowledge of all aspects of intervnetions, work overs, drilling, and completions
Understanding of geophysical, geological, and reservoir engineering considerations.
Working knowledge of applicable legislation
Communication and collaborative skills with other groups is essential. Including but not limited to, well engineering, EH&S;, subsurface, and management stakeholders
